NAU Women’s Tennis Ready for Weekend Competition at GCU Invitational

FLAGSTAFF, Ariz. (October 30, 2019) – With their fall season winding to a close, the Northern Arizona women's tennis heads south on the I-17 to Glendale this weekend for the GCU Invitational running Friday through Sunday at the Paseo Racquet Center.
 
"For most of our players, this will be their last tournament of season," said head coach Ewa Bogusz. "We want to see them finish strong. It'll also be a dual format so our freshmen will be able to see what it's like to play next to their teammates and it'll be a valuable experience."
 
The Lumberjacks will be joined at the GCU Invitational by the host, Grand Canyon, as well as Big Sky rival Northern Colorado. Unlike the bracket-styled tournaments the team has played so far this fall, this weekend will be a dual match format with three doubles matches and six singles matches.
 
Sophomore Adrianna Sosnowska and Emilie Haakansson will lead NAU's contingent of seven players in Glendale this season. Sosnowska's 8-4 singles record this fall is second on the team to only senior Chiara Tomasetti, who will be prepping for next week's Oracle ITA National Fall Championships following her regional singles title. Haakansson is third on the team with a 7-3 record.
 
Sosnowska and Haakansson were among a number of 'Jacks who posted positive results at last weekend's ITA Mountain Regional Championships. Sosnowska and Haakansson combined for five singles wins at the regional tournament, with freshmen Elinor Beazley and Mimi Bland also posting two wins apiece. The two freshmen have six wins each this fall.
 
The Lumberjacks' pairing of Sosnowska and Bland finished as the regional runner-up last week, tallying a 5-1 record during the five-day tourney in Las Vegas. They are pacing the Lumberjacks in doubles play this fall with a 7-2 record overall.
 
"We were in it together every match last week," Bogusz said. "They were supporting each other every match, whether it was a regional final or a back draw match, and that is a coach's dream to see."
